Koelreuteria /kɛlrʊˈtɪəriə/, also known as chinese lantern tree, is a genus of three species of flowering plants in the family Sapindaceae, native to southern and eastern Asia, as well as the island of Fiji. Many fossil species are also known, suggesting that this genus had a wider range in the past.
